欢迎访问 生活随笔!

生活随笔

当前位置: 首页 > 编程语言 > c/c++ >内容正文

c/c++

Effective C++条款01: 视C++为一个语言联邦

发布时间:2024/4/17 c/c++ 58 豆豆
生活随笔 收集整理的这篇文章主要介绍了 Effective C++条款01: 视C++为一个语言联邦 小编觉得挺不错的,现在分享给大家,帮大家做个参考.

      一开始C++定义为:C with Classes。

      如今的C++已经是一个多重范型编程语言,可以把C++视为有四个次语言组成的联邦语言。

  • C。C++任然以C为基础。区块、语句、预处理、内置语言类型、数组、指针等。搞笑编程守则映射出C语言的局限:没有模版、没有异常、没有重载。
  • Object-Orited C++。这部分是C with Classes诉求的:class、封装、集成、多态、virtual函数等。
  • Template C++。模版威力强大,带来了崭新的泛型编程,即TMP(模版元编程)。
  • STL。STL是template程序库。它对容器、迭代器、算法以及函数对象的规则有极佳的紧密配合与协调。
  • 转载于:https://www.cnblogs.com/kaituorensheng/p/3590960.html

    总结

    以上是生活随笔为你收集整理的Effective C++条款01: 视C++为一个语言联邦的全部内容,希望文章能够帮你解决所遇到的问题。

    如果觉得生活随笔网站内容还不错,欢迎将生活随笔推荐给好友。